The small room was slick with darkened ichor, its coloration not dissimilar to that of a star-speckled night sky. 

It coated the floor, the seating, and the carpet- the unique, iron-esque scent of viscera greatly overwhelming the now faint stench of cactus green. 

 

The devil’s abused, slashed corpse lies front and center, settled peacefully within his seat in an almost regal manner, befitting of the young devil’s unwanted title-
 


The Black King.
₊˚ ✧ ━━━━━━━⊱⛧⊰━━━━━━━ ✧ ₊˚

In the days before, Shahan and Vysryana had sat within that same room.
Idle conversation flowed with abundance and ease,
The topic of redemption at its forefront.
 

“What inspired your want for disconnection, if I may ask?” - “Was it the boy?”

“‘Cause, like… what I said about my dad. I couldn't let him grow up with a warlock for a father, cause I know what that'd do to him.”

“One's environment shapes them. You made the smart choice, not only for yourself, but for Ismail.”

“I don't want him to grow up in the village, and I can't raise him anywhere else unless I disconnect. So… the easiest choice I've ever made, really. I'd do it a million times over. Or… well, I'm still a warlock. But you get the idea, right?”

₊˚ ✧ ━━━━━━━⊱⛧⊰━━━━━━━ ✧ ₊˚


Despite what Shahan had done, she still saw that impossibly small child sitting within Norland’s tavern.
He had never eaten anything that was not necessary for survival, and so she and her brother brought various sweets and flavorful foods to his home.

When Vysryana discovered Shahan’s mutilated corpse, she did not see the wicked thing he had grown to be. She did not see his bloodied form, slashes cutting through the brands that denoted his infernal magic, but that dull-eyed child.

Perhaps if Fate had denoted any other end for Shahan, she would have seen those eyes glimmer, his will to live and lust for life restored once more. Instead, his gaze remains dull- staring on and on, unseeing and glassy.
 

₊˚ ✧ ━━━━━━━⊱⛧⊰━━━━━━━ ✧ ₊˚


A letter is clutched within hands of steel and flesh; two mechanical eyes clicking and whirring, flickering from side to side as it is read over and over again.
 

Vys,
I didn't really know you very well, but you were very, very kind to me at a time when you definitely should not have been. You're awesome.
Sorry I probably killed myself in your house, and all. Take care of Ismail, please. Keep him away from Maheen. Don't let him be evil.
-S


Vysryana contemplates, as she will for some time, how those he was raised with will react.
Her own mourning for the child she had watched grow up from the sidelines is set aside, for the time being, so she might be a steadying force
if any choose to seek such a thing from her.
